Keycard Systems
Key card access systems stand as one of the most prevalent security control solutions, offering a reliable and efficient way to oversee entry to secure areas. These systems use electronic cards that you can easily swipe or tap at entry points, granting or denying access based on your credentials. You'll find key card systems in various forms, including smart cards, proximity cards, and magnetic stripe cards, each delivering different levels of security and convenience. They're frequently integrated with software to record access logs, enhancing security by tracking who enters and exits. Furthermore, you can easily withdraw access when needed, making them a adaptable solution for evolving security needs. Overall, key card systems enhance building security while ensuring only authorized personnel can enter protected areas.
Biometric Security Authentication Approaches
As organizations seek more secure access control solutions, biometric authentication methods have grown in acceptance for their capacity to provide a unique and reliable way to verify identity. These methods include fingerprint recognition, facial recognition, and iris scanning. Each offers distinct advantages, making them well-suited for diverse environments. For instance, fingerprint scanners are rapid and user-friendly, while facial recognition systems can operate from a distance, improving convenience. Iris scans provide high accuracy, minimizing the chance of false positives. By implementing biometric solutions, you can significantly reduce unauthorized access and enhance overall security. Additionally, these technologies often integrate seamlessly with existing security systems, permitting smoother implementation and improved protection for your business's assets.
Mobile Access Solutions
Biometric authentication systems have revolutionized access control, yet mobile access solutions are now elevating security to the next level. With the growth of smartphones, you can access doors using mobile apps, Bluetooth, or NFC technology. This not only increases convenience but also improves security by eliminating the need for physical keys. You can easily oversee access permissions in real-time, providing or removing access from your device. Mobile access solutions also enable multi-factor authentication, adding an extra layer of protection. Additionally, they can integrate seamlessly with existing systems, making implementation straightforward. By implementing these solutions, you streamline entry processes, minimize the risk of unauthorized access, and create a more secure environment for everyone in your building.

Future Trends in Access Control Security Solutions
As technology advances, access control security solutions are prepared to face significant transformations that will reshape how we protect our spaces. You'll see a shift towards integrating artificial intelligence and machine learning, strengthening threat detection and response. Biometric authentication will become more ubiquitous, making it more challenging for unauthorized individuals to gain access. Cloud-based systems will present greater flexibility, allowing you to manage security remotely with real-time monitoring. Mobile credentials will take the place of traditional keycards, offering a seamless user experience. Additionally, the rise of IoT devices will support smarter, interconnected security systems that adjust to your specific needs. Implementing these trends will not only optimize security but also empower you to sustain a safer environment.
